About Eastbrook

Eastbrook is a small village located in the Vale of Glamorgan, Wales, within the CF64 postcode area. The village is primarily residential, featuring a mix of traditional Welsh homes and modern developments. It is situated near the coast, providing easy access to local beaches and scenic walks along the shoreline.

The village is served by a few local amenities, including a primary school and a small shop, catering to the daily needs of residents. Eastbrook is well-connected by public transport, with regular bus services linking it to nearby towns and cities. The surrounding area offers opportunities for outdoor activities, including hiking and cycling, making it a suitable location for those who enjoy exploring the natural landscape of Wales.

Household Income in Eastbrook ONS 2023

The average total household income in Eastbrook is approximately £53,396 a year before tax, 3% below the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£41,232.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Eastbrook ONS 2025

There are approximately 1,354 active businesses based in Eastbrook, around 36 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 90%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 15 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Eastbrook

Of the 16,396 households in and around Eastbrook, 76% are owned, 10% are socially rented and 15%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
